Brilliant.org: Brilliant.org is an online platform that offers math and science problems and courses to help people improve their logical reasoning and problem-solving abilities. It uses interactive quizzes and puzzles to make STEM subjects more engaging.

Lingualia: Lingualia is a language learning platform that uses spaced repetition and adaptive algorithms to help learners master new languages efficiently. Its lessons focus on practical conversation and real-world usage.

Pros & Cons Analysis

Brilliant.org
Brilliant.org

Pros

  • Makes learning math and science more engaging
  • Develops critical thinking and problem solving skills
  • Adaptive content keeps users challenged
  • Affordable compared to tutoring
  • Good for all levels from beginner to advanced

Cons

  • Limited number of free problems per day
  • Not a full curriculum replacement
  • Some courses are still in development
  • Mobile app lacks some desktop features
  • Can feel repetitive at times
Lingualia
Lingualia

Pros

  • Effective memorization of vocabulary
  • Lessons adapt to your level
  • Develops practical conversation skills
  • Immersive audio content
  • Detailed explanations of grammar
  • Useful for beginner to advanced learners

Cons

  • Limited languages available
  • Mobile app lacks some features
  • Can feel repetitive at times
  • Writing practice is light
  • Pricing may be expensive for some
